## Build Provenance: string-extract.py

The Murmont localization extractor runs as a pre-build step and writes its output manifest alongside the compiled catalog. Reviewers should verify that the manifest commit matches the source revision under review, since drift here has caused shipped placeholder strings before. Each extraction run is identified by the token below.

pipeline stamp: htk9_ce63042d9

Leadership Review Briefing — Project Cindermast

For the board of Aldevane Systems. Cindermast is fourteen weeks behind plan. Root causes: vendor slippage and an underscoped data-migration phase. Revised completion: Q2. Budget overrun held to 8% after descoping the reporting module. Delivery lead replaced; weekly checkpoints now in place. Recommendation: approve revised plan. One confidential item follows.

board note of kageg-bahof: The renewal with Holwynax Holdings closes at $2 million a year, 5 percent below the last contract. Project Ulaath slips by two quarters because of the supplier delay.

Subject: Webhook retry cut-over complete

Plugin authors: the Quillhook delivery cut-over finished last night. Retries now use exponential backoff with jitter instead of fixed 30s intervals. Max attempts dropped from 10 to 6. A 410 response permanently disables the endpoint; 429 honors Retry-After. Dead-lettered events are retained seven days. Update handlers for idempotency. The active delivery settings are listed below.

deployment values, tafof-taduf:
pelius:
  pin: 6508
  tenant: praiel
  seal: seal_4e33a2f4
  metrics_host: metrics.pelius.plorvagrid.corp
  standby_team: druix
  escalation: juldor-norius
  nonce: 5db598